  1. Changing your wireless number is free when you self-serve on Fido.ca. You'll need to set up a new voicemail and greeting, and saved messages cannot be transferred to a new number. By changing your phone number during your billing cycle, your airtime minutes, add-ons and monthly plan charges will be distributed between your old number and new one.

  2. To change a wireless number: Sign into MyRogers. Select the wireless number you’d like to change. Under Quick links, select Change my wireless number. Choose the province and city where you’ll be making most of your calls, then select Find available numbers. Choose a phone number from the options listed, then select Next.

  4. Steps in My Account. Once logged into My Account, follow the steps below: Navigate to the My Plan & Device tab. Scroll down and select the option to Change Phone Number. Select a Province and City for the drop down lists available. Click Check Available Phone Numbers. Select a new phone number from the available options.

  7. May 3, 2021 · The easiest way to port your number is, of course, to call your new carrier or sign up in a store. However, many carriers also offer a way to do this online when you get a new plan. Just keep your eyes peeled for a checkbox that says ‘Port forward.’. If you port your number online, you’ll be sent a temporary SIM card with a temporary number.
